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Put all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and hairspray in your checked luggage. Any liquids or gels in your carry-on bag lar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) will be confiscated by security. Pointed or sharp objects, like your precious Swiss Army knife, and products which are explosive or flammable, such as flares, chemicals agents and matches, are also prohibited.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Iven?
A little pre-planning before your flight will help make your trip to Iven quick and painless. Below you'll find some useful tips for a stress-free journey through security:

  • Airport security personnel first need to see that you have a valid ID and boarding pass before anything else. Have them ready to show.
  • Time to strip down. Well kind of. Your belt, jacket, keys and other items in your pocket, like your headphones, will need to go through the X-ray machine. Make your life easier by removing them as your turn draws near.
  • All your electronic devices, including your tablet and phone, will also need to be separately scanned.
  • Don't forget to remove gels and liquids from your carry-on luggage. They usually need to be sent through the X-ray separately. Each item should be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) and everything must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-close bag.
  • Slip-on shoes are a good footwear choice as you're less likely to be asked to remove them when going through security. Big boots and other heavy shoes are usually subjected to extra screening.
  • Avoid taking prohibited items in your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p objects like a pocket knife or tools, put them in your checked luggage. They won't be allowed in the cabin.
